HyperDic: caretta_caretta

English > 1 sense of the expression Caretta caretta:
NOUNanimalCaretta caretta, loggerhead, loggerhead turtlevery large carnivorous sea turtle
English > Caretta caretta: 1 sense > noun 1, animal
MeaningVery large carnivorous sea turtle; wide-ranging in warm open seas.
Synonymsloggerhead, loggerhead turtle
Member ofCaretta, genus Carettaloggerhead turtles
Broadersea turtle, marine turtleAny of various large turtles with limbs modified into flippers
Spanishtortuga boba
CatalanCaretta caretta, tortuga babaua

©2001-22 · HyperDic hyper-dictionary · Contact

English | Spanish | Catalan
Privacy | Robots

Valid XHTML 1.0 Strict